Preliminary Filing and Documentation
When starting separation proceedings, the very first step commonly entails submitting the needed paperwork with the suitable court. This documentation usually includes a request or grievance for divorce, which lays out the factors for the divorce and any kind of ask for kid wardship, support, or division of assets.
You'll need to gather important documents such as marriage certifications, financial records, and any type of pertinent contracts or prenuptial arrangements.
As soon as the documentation is filed, you'll require to ensure that your spouse is appropriately offered with the divorce papers. This can be done via a process-server or licensed mail, depending on the needs of your territory.
After your spouse has actually been offered, they'll have a specific quantity of time to reply to the request.

Court Appearances and Procedures
Routinely, browsing court appearances and treatments during divorce can be a daunting process. As soon as your separation situation is submitted, you may be needed to attend numerous court appearances. These looks can consist of hearings related to short-lived orders, negotiation seminars, and eventually, the test. It's necessary to familiarize yourself with the particular treatments and rules of the court where your instance is being listened to. See to it to clothe properly for court, get here promptly, and conduct on your own professionally.
During court looks, you might need to attend to the judge directly, so it's important to talk plainly and confidently.
Understanding court treatments is essential to guarantee that your case proceeds smoothly. Prior to each court appearance, evaluate any needed documents and prepare any kind of records or evidence required. In addition, be prepared to respond to inquiries from the judge or your lawyer. It's vital to adhere to any guidelines provided by the court and stick to deadlines for submitting paperwork.
Final Judgment and Results
Acquiring a final judgment in a separation instance marks a considerable turning point in the legal process. This judgment indicates the official end of the marital relationship and lays out the decisions made by the court regarding crucial issues such as division of assets, youngster wardship, visitation civil liberties, and financial backing. The final judgment is legally binding and needs both parties to stick to its terms.
In divorce instances, end results can differ widely based upon the specifics of each situation and the decisions made by the court. The final judgment might lead to a variety of results, consisting of one party being awarded key protection of the children, the department of property and assets, and the resolution of spousal support or child support payments. It's vital to meticulously assess the final judgment to understand your rights and commitments moving on.
Inevitably, the final judgment in a divorce instance intends to supply a fair and equitable resolution to the concerns available, permitting both celebrations to move on with their lives individually.
